[docs] def process_ICA_single(self, num_ICA: int, return_data: bool = False, exclude_timestamps: Optional[List[str]] = None, exclude_timestamps_skip: int = 5, **kwargs): """ Process the data for a single run of ICA. This function performs Independent Component Analysis (ICA) for a specified number of components. It fits the ICA model to the provided data after optionally excluding certain timestamps. The resulting features are then saved, and the model can be optionally returned. Parameters: num_ICA (int): The number of Independent Components to reduce the data to. return_data (bool): Flag indicating whether to return data after processing. Default is False. exclude_timestamps (Optional[List[str]]): List of timestamps to exclude from the data before fitting. exclude_timestamps_skip (int): The number of data points to skip for each excluded timestamp. **kwargs: Additional keyword arguments that can be passed to the FastICA model. Returns: Tuple: If return_data is True, it returns a tuple containing: - The Explained Variance (%) of the ICA. - The Mean Squared Error (MSE) of the ICA. - The trained ICA model. - The extracted features after transformation. Side Effects: - Saves the trained ICA model in a pickle file. - Saves the features in a numpy .npz file. """ print(f'Performing ICA for {num_ICA} ICAs') ica_model_path = (f'{self.data_savepath}ICA/{self.data_network}_{self.data_station}_{self.data_location}_' f'{self.network_name}_dimension_{num_ICA}.pickle') # check if reduction exists already if os.path.exists(ica_model_path) and self.ica_overwrite_previous_models is False: print(' Using pre-calculated model') with open(ica_model_path, 'rb') as f: model = pickle.load(f) else: # else fit kwargs['max_iter'] = 1000 if kwargs.get('max_iter') is None else kwargs.get('max_iter') kwargs['whiten'] = 'unit-variance' if kwargs.get('whiten') is None else kwargs.get('whiten') model = FastICA(n_components=num_ICA, random_state=42, **kwargs) # Exclude any timestamps scat_coeff_data = self.data_scat_coef_vectorized.copy() if exclude_timestamps is not None: for ts in exclude_timestamps: print( f'Timestamp {UTCDateTime(ts)} - ' f'{UTCDateTime(ts) + (self.network_segment * exclude_timestamps_skip)} has been excluded from the ' f'Scaling fit and Model fit.') ts_index = self._get_index_from_UTC_timestamp(ts) scat_coeff_data = np.delete(scat_coeff_data, np.s_[ts_index:ts_index + exclude_timestamps_skip], 0) print('Fitting FastICA') model.fit(scat_coeff_data) features = model.transform(scat_coeff_data) features_inverse = model.inverse_transform(features) score_exp_var = explained_variance_score(scat_coeff_data, features_inverse) score_mse = mean_squared_error(scat_coeff_data, features_inverse) print(f' ICAs #{num_ICA}: Explained Variance {score_exp_var * 100:0.5f}%: MSE {score_mse:0.5f}') self.ica = model self.ica_number_components = num_ICA self.ica_features = features self.ica_explained_variance_score = score_exp_var # SAVE ICA MODEL IN PICKLE FILE with open(ica_model_path, 'wb') as handle: pickle.dump(model, handle, protocol=pickle.HIGHEST_PROTOCOL) # save the features np.savez( f'{self.data_savepath}data/{self.data_network}_{self.data_station}_{self.data_location}_' f'{self.network_name}_features_{num_ICA}.npz', features=features, features_inverse=features_inverse, score_explained_variance=score_exp_var, score_mse=score_mse) if return_data: return score_exp_var, score_mse, model, features
